Fitzroy North's interior streets are excellent for building the foundational skills that translate to safe driving everywhere. The suburb's Victorian terrace grid creates narrow streets with consistent parked-car environments on both sides, which develops spatial awareness and slow-speed control faster than wide suburban roads do. Edinburgh Gardens and the Merri Creek trail create pedestrian crossing points and shared zones that require real anticipation and careful low-speed management. St Georges Road and Queens Parade on the suburb's boundaries introduce learner drivers to multi-lane arterial conditions with merging and lane discipline requirements. The proximity to Carlton and Fitzroy means that any lesson in Fitzroy North can naturally extend to inner-city roads, tram environments, and the Carlton VicRoads test area within minutes. Getting your learner permit is the first official step in the Victorian driving licence journey, and it's more involved than many students expect. The VicRoads Learner Permit Test Online is a structured 4–6 hour interactive course covering road rules, hazard identification, and safe driving behaviours — it's not a simple multiple-choice quiz you can breeze through unprepared. The Hazard Perception Test is a compulsory step in the Victorian licence journey that catches many learners off guard — it's designed to assess how quickly and accurately you identify developing hazards on the road, and it's harder than most students expect when they sit it for the first time. Unlike the learner permit knowledge test, which tests what you know, the HPT tests how you respond — requiring fast, accurate recognition of the moment a hazard becomes critical, not just noticing that something is present. Victoria has specific and time-sensitive rules for overseas licence holders: if you're moving to Victoria and plan to live here for more than six months, you must convert your overseas driver's licence to a Victorian one or risk losing the right to drive legally. The process varies depending on which country your licence was issued in — some countries have recognition agreements that make conversion straightforward, while others require a formal assessment that includes a drive test. Night driving lessons serve a dual purpose for Victorian learner drivers: they count as double logbook hours (one hour of night driving with a supervisor records as two hours in your logbook), and they develop a genuinely distinct set of skills that daytime driving doesn't. Visibility, depth perception, and hazard identification all work differently after dark, and many learners who are confident drivers in daylight find their first night experience genuinely challenging.
